WS2812B

Тема в разделе "AVR", создана пользователем timsoon, 15 авг 2015.

  1. timsoon

    timsoon В доску свой

    Сообщения:
    380
    Симпатии:
    46
    Род занятий:
    КИПиА, it, и прочее
    Адрес:
    г.Капчагай
    Приветствую всех форумчан. Вот задался темой управления светодиодами .
    Из всего асортимента приглянудись ws2812b. Управление ими, хочу реализовать на авр. На гитхаде нашел исхожники, но попробовать не успел.
    Теперь вопрос: кто-нибудь с ними работал? И еще интерфейс связи между светодиодами заинтересовал какая макс длина интересно.
     
    : Led, Ws2812
  2. Ержан

    Ержан Частый гость

    Сообщения:
    45
    Симпатии:
    1
    Добрый вечер! Я подключал на 60 светодиодов. Управлял pic16f628a с кварцом 20мгц. Контроллер принимал команды с компьютера и зажигал заданные светодиоды нужным цветом. Проект был коммерческим. Библиотеку для ws2812b брал у alex-exe.ru По рекомендаций в интернете на первый светодиод команды передавал через резистор 200 ом, остальные напрямую вход к выходу. Также работала микросхема ws2811 плюс 5мм RGB светодиод.
  3. timsoon

    timsoon В доску свой

    Сообщения:
    380
    Симпатии:
    46
    Род занятий:
    КИПиА, it, и прочее
    Адрес:
    г.Капчагай
    Интересно, а исходников не удалось раздобыть?
    И как работала схема: помехи , глюки, отказы были?
  4. Ержан

    Ержан Частый гость

    Сообщения:
    45
    Симпатии:
    1
    Под свой контроллер pic16f628a исходник писал сам на ассемблере, да там протокол очень простой. Также исходник выложен alex-exe.ru/radio/light/rgb-addressable-strip-ws2811/ На счет помех не знаю так как проверял у себя в лабораторий и не было возможности проверить в пром. условиях. Все было хорошо. По техзаданию контроллер работал в аптеке а там нет источников помех как в пром. зонах. По рекомендаций в разных форумах на первый ws2812b команды передовал через резистор 200 ом и у меня не было проблем, гонял 2 дня, может мало гонял. На форумах писали если напрямую подключить ножку контроллера к ws2812b то он может перестать принимать команды, но у меня такого не было. Свои исходники я не нашел в компе скорее всего стер уже. А вы что собираете если не секрет? Какой (avr) контроллер хотите поставить?

Поделиться этой страницей